>> WA historically has been the "engineering" show. 
>> Deeper dives. An "Animal Farm" track (vendors doing 
>> their deep dives like the old and much cherished 
>> Animal Farm shows). Turn-out is always smaller 
>> because there are less business/accounting/HR focused 
>> tracks. 
>> 
>> Obviously the circumstances could be better - but WA 
>> has a very different feel than WISPAPALOOZA. I love 
>> both shows (and I'm not just saying that).
